Superintendent Salary at Industrial Valve BETA

How much does an Industrial Valve Superintendent make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Superintendent at Industrial Valve is $98,552, which translates to approximately $47 per hour. Salaries for Superintendent at Industrial Valve typically range from $70,644 to $106,874,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

We are the largest full service valve company in the Southeast with offices in Mobile, AL; Cleveland, TN; Bastrop, LA; and Evansville, IN. We offer New Valves as well as repair and service for Used Valves. From Safety/Relief Valves to Actuators to Surplus Valves, Industrial Valve is your single source provider for all your valve needs.

The Superintendent is the company representative who has the primary responsibility for all field operations, including the coordination of subcontractors’ work. Superintendent is responsible for all field activities associated with the project, including ultimate responsibility for implementation and supervision of all field construction work by subcontractors and self-performed work. The individual in this role shares responsibility with the Project Manager for developing the project budget, actively participating in the preconstruction phase, and ensuring that the project is built on time, within budget, and according to company policies and procedures. The Superintendent also manages and mentors Assistant Superintendents and other field personnel. 30 hours of OSHA training once every four years required, as well as first aid and CPR training.
